HB 2947 - DIGEST

Provides that each commissioner of a port district in a county with one million or more residents must serve in a full-time employment capacity and must be compensated for the performance of his or her official services and duties. Each commissioner must have at least one full-time administrative staff member and one full-time confidential assistant.

Establishes the legislative task force on port district structure and operation.

Provides that each port shall maintain a database on a public web site of all contracts.

Provides that personal services may be procured only in certain circumstances.

Provides that emergency contracts and sole source contracts shall be filed with the commission and made available for public inspection.

Requires that the Washington public ports association shall: (1) Report annually to the governor and the appropriate committees of the senate and house of representatives on sole source contracts;

(2) Adopt uniform guidelines for management of personal service contracts by all ports; and

(3) Provide a training course for port personnel responsible for executing and managing personal service contracts.
